Abstract: Noiselike spectra of the microwave cavity of an electron-spin-resonance (ESR) spectrometer are investigated. A hypothesis about the ferromagnetic origin of the observed absorption based on available experimental data is suggested. It is shown that the presence of noiselike spectra of the cavity walls limits the sensitivity of modern ESR spectrometers.
